Got in the car the other day and turned the engine over and the speedometer went nuts. It seems to sit at about 35 to 45 and move around some from that when driving but is very erratic.
Has anyone had this problem and can help?
My guess is that it is in the speedometer itself. I am convinced I can hear a noise from the instrument.

Any help would be greatly appreciated.

The worm drive and movement has broken. The speedo unit is sealed/crimped like a tin can top. I removed mine and opened it up but needed to take it to a speedo shop to have it reassembled due to the fact I did not have a rolled crimper to put the top back on.

Look for a local VDO repair place.

You can save a bit by removing the speedo from the binnicale and sending it to the shop. Use a bit of liquid soap under the rubber ring holding the speedo and remove through the front of the facia.

Sanj has a got a good pictorial instruction for removing the binnicale top, 2 screws and 10mm bolt and it comes right off. http://turboesprit.tripod.com/binnacle.html
